    Chris S.

    I tried Pollon for lunch. I was greeted right away when I entered and ask if it was take out or eat in. Eating in I took a booth and was asked what I wanted to drink and given the menus. Monday through Friday they had a lunch special which consisted of picking an appetizer and an entree. The restaurant It was very clean and neat. I got a Unsweetened tea, Appetizer 'Causa De Pollo' and Entree 'Tallarin Saltado De Carne'. The Causa De Pollo was a lunch size that was delicious. It was I think a scoop of rich mash potato's with a scoop of like chicken salad on top with a delish sauce. The Tallarin Saltado De Carne was a very good stir fried noodle beef dish with red onion, tomatoes and scallions. I splurged and had flan for dessert. For me it was a great introduction to Peruvian Cuisine.

    Cheryl Emily B.

    Being in the area I decided to give this Pervian cuisine small place a try. I am typically skeptical of Spanish food these days as I prefer not to bother if I can make it better to my liking at home. I was wrong though, I got the rice and beans and salad with yucca fries all to give a try. The rice used seemed like jasmine rice and it was freshly made (as I don't put it past these days to get stale food - pet peeve). The beans/frijoles had flavor and paired well with it. The yucca fries also piping hot and fresh - not overly oily either, my other pet peeve.. The side salad and side dressing was a nice touch to have with the lunch. I read in the past reviews they have good dips/sauces so I made sure to ask. She offered garlic sauce, a hot green sauce, and salad dressing I went with all 3 and it did a great job of enhancing it all. Service was busy but still welcoming - I forgot to order my typical mango smoothie and despite someone waiting in line she was still nice about having to ring me up twice. The mango smoothie half milk half water is my thing and it didn't disappoint here. The lighting was lacking a bit inside and it was busy so I decided to take it out and eat outside. Also, not sure if service is always quick there but my food came out in about 5-10 minutes while still fresh! Il def be back for another dish.

    Kristopher R.

    I have only now just found out about this place? We found it on a lark because my son was hungry- but for something we never had. So I threw out the idea of Peruvian food?! And with that; we came across this wonderful restaurant. It is a little hidden, right next to a bar and in a shopping center. Very subtle, but it's there! It isn't a huge steakhouse by any means, but big enough for a couple of families and a few couples/duos in search of a great meal. I got a chicken and rice dish with onions atop and mixed veggies within. My son got a fish dish which looked delicious, and had what seemed like a full salad as a side - with rice. Both meals were tremendous! So much food! And seasoned just right. The rice was cooked perfectly- just dry enough so that it made you drink to wash it down as opposed to drying out your mouth. Furthermore, the place is clean and staff friendly. The woman who took our order sensed my son didn't know what he was getting with his first choice (raw fish) , so she guided him to something more his liking. Service was quick and prices are sensible. Great food and service. Will be back!
